Additional costs.
There are some third party fees that are part of going to camp. These are paid directly to organisations like the US government and background check agencies as part of the J1 Visa requirements.
Criminal Background Check - £99
U.S. Visa Application (MRV) Fee - $185 USD (Paid to U.S. Embassy)
Flights to the U.S. - Price varies
Additional costs are subject to change.

Frequently asked questions

How long is summer camp?

Camp Leaders participants spend 9 to 11 weeks at camp in the US during the summer season. Camp counselors stay for around 9 weeks, while support staff stay for 10 weeks. The season typically runs from early June through late August. After camp ends, you have up to 30 days to travel around America.

Are accommodation and food included?

Yes, your accommodation and meals are included. You'll stay on camp grounds with other staff members, and all your meals are provided - breakfast, lunch and dinner. Any extra treats during your time off are up to you.

Do I have to be a student to go to summer camp?

No, you don't need to be a student to be a camp counselor. You just need to be 18 by June 1st and have a clean criminal background check. Support staff roles do require student status due to visa regulations.

Will I earn some spending money during my time at camp?

Yes! You'll earn spending money during your time at camp. All camp roles come with a guaranteed minimum pocket money, and certain positions earn even more. Please visit our pricing page for more details and the most up to date information.

Do I get any time to explore America after camp?

Yes! As part of your J1 visa, you get 30 days after camp to explore America. This means once your camp contract ends, you can travel anywhere in the US during those 30 days, or head straight home if you prefer.
